Output 44687748cfd5aecd7e1e425ba5aed297406fc44de51a0415372f05028fba5bfb:1

value
431660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e05ac6866d97ba81c527aac7e0c17a3383193a7 OP_EQUAL
address
38oZRhuE9q3Mn8jvyBzHb4pTrNpdhExPFt
transaction
44687748cfd5aecd7e1e425ba5aed297406fc44de51a0415372f05028fba5bfb
confirmations
317416
spent
true